Meaning of "hydrogen cyanide"
Hydrogen cyanide is a highly toxic chemical compound that consists of hydrogen, carbon, and nitrogen. It is a colorless liquid or gas with a strong odor of bitter almonds. Hydrogen cyanide is used in various industrial processes, such as chemical synthesis and fumigation, but can also be produced naturally in certain plants and seeds

- A colourless, very poisonous, volatile liquid, HCN, used in the production of dyes, plastics and fumigants; it dissolves in water to form hydrocyanic acid and reacts with bases to form cyanides, and with some organic compounds to form nitriles.
